Wright Jumps Into Fourth on All-Time Top Ten List At Mizzou’s Gans Creek Classic
10/1/2021 11:15:00 AM | Women's Cross Country
Senior Dani Wright placed fourth on Murray State’s top-ten all-time performance at the Mizzou’s Gans Creek Classic on Friday
The Murray State women's cross country team competed at the Gans Creek Classic, hosted by Mizzou, on Friday, Oct. 1 in Columbia, Missouri.
Senior Dani Wright jumped onto Murray State's All-Time Top Ten List (6k) with a mark of 22:09.6 to place fourth all time.
Sixteen other schools competed at the meet, including host-Mizzou, Texas A&M, Iowa, Baylor, Kansas and Kansas State.
"We came off of a two week break from racing and today was a great opportunity to run on a larger stage," said distance coach Jordan Johnston.
Wright completed the course in 22:09.6 to take 38th on the individual leaderboard, a time that is fourth-best in Murray State history in the 6k.
Seniors Jessica Stein ran a 23:05.9, while Emma Creviston was finished just behind her, in 23:09.3. Freshmen Hope Ware and Ainsley Smith rounded out the Racers' top five with times of 23:25.2 and 24:17.5.
Murray State returns home to host the Racer Open at the Miller Memorial Golf Course on Friday, Oct. 15.
